About MyMedicare.gov

As of May 2006, Medicare beneficiaries are able to access www.MyMedicare.gov - the Medicare Beneficiary Portal. This is an Internet portal allowing registered beneficiaries the ability to view eligibility and entitlement information, enrollment information, deductible and address of record information. Beginning as a pilot program for Indiana residents in December of 2004, the program has now become nationwide.

Total registered users have surpassed 140,000 people with an average of 400 new registrants a day. Once registered online, users are able to access the past six months of claims history. Eventually, the Center for Medicare and Medicaid Services hopes to have 15 months displayed for its users. www.MyMedicare.gov and the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) are encouraging Medicare beneficiaries to utilize this adjudicated claims information.

As a user of this site, individuals may now conduct the following business online:

  • Access the status of your adjudicated claims as well as search for a specific claim
  • View claim status (excluding Part D claims)
  • Order a duplicate Medicare Summary Notice (MSN) or replacement Medicare card
  • View eligibility, entitlement and preventive services information
  • View enrollment information including prescription drug plans
  • View or modify your drug list and pharmacy information
  • Order replacement Medicare card
  • View address of record with Medicare and Part B deductible status
  • Access online forms, publications and messages sent by CMS.

To register for the site, individuals will need their Medicare card. After the registration is complete, a letter with your password will be sent to the users home up to 14 days after an individual registered online. For more information, contact 1-800-MEDICARE or go online to www.MyMedicare.gov.
